dude, the minute you see 'swap in use' above 0 means you've ran out of physical RAM. When you've ran out of physical RAM you're gonna page in and out 'IF' you have several active processes.
Yep and once the original paging in has been accomplished and the program is resident you should see very little paging in and out - yet your free memory is going to be very low and your swap usage high.

I admit I would have liked to see 512 MB of actual RAM - but simply saying there was almost none free doesnt tell is anything I need vmstat output
